Why Build a Bridge Game?
Bridge-building games have a unique appeal because they combine creativity with problem-solving. Players are not just passively consuming content; they actively design and test their own structures, learning about tension, compression, and balance in a hands-on way. This interactive format makes bridge-building games popular among educators, casual gamers, and simulation enthusiasts alike. Creating your own bridge game allows you to tailor the experience to a particular audience or learning objective. For example, you could focus on realistic physics to teach engineering concepts, or you could emphasize fun and quirky challenges that appeal to a broader audience. No matter the approach, the core principle remains the same: players want to feel the satisfaction of constructing a functional and robust bridge that can withstand various stresses.Core Elements of a Build a Bridge Game
Before diving into the development process, it’s important to identify the key elements that make a bridge-building game engaging and effective.1. Realistic Physics Simulation
2. Intuitive Building Interface
The game’s controls and building tools should be easy to understand and use. Players want to experiment freely without being bogged down by complicated menus or awkward placement mechanics. Drag-and-drop interfaces, snapping grids, and clear visual feedback on stress points can greatly enhance the user experience.3. Progressive Challenge Levels
To keep players engaged, a well-designed bridge game includes a variety of levels that gradually increase in difficulty. Early stages might involve simple crossings over small gaps, while later challenges require complex truss designs or multi-span bridges capable of supporting heavy vehicles. Including different terrain types or environmental factors like wind and earthquakes can also add depth and variety to gameplay.4. Rewarding Feedback and Failure Mechanics
A good bridge game provides players with immediate feedback on their designs. Visual indicators showing which parts of the bridge are under strain or about to fail help players learn and improve. When a bridge collapses, the animation should clearly illustrate why the failure occurred, turning setbacks into valuable lessons rather than frustrating dead ends.Designing the Gameplay Mechanics
The mechanics define how players interact with the game world and what goals they pursue. Let’s explore some popular gameplay features commonly found in bridge-building games.Structural Components and Materials
Offering a variety of components such as beams, cables, pillars, and joints encourages creativity. Each material can have distinct properties—wood may be light but weak under tension, steel might be heavy but strong, and cables could handle tension but not compression. Players should be able to combine these elements to create trusses, arches, suspension bridges, or cantilever bridges. This diversity enriches the gameplay and introduces players to real-world engineering concepts.Budget and Resource Management
Load Testing and Vehicles
Once the bridge is built, players test it by sending vehicles or weights across. Different vehicle types—trucks, trains, or pedestrians—can impose varying loads, requiring players to anticipate and design accordingly. Some games even simulate dynamic stresses like moving loads or vibrations, demanding robust engineering solutions.Technical Tips for Developing a Build a Bridge Game
If you’re embarking on building your own bridge game, here are some practical tips to guide your development process:- Choose the right development platform: Game engines such as Unity or Unreal Engine offer comprehensive tools and physics engines suitable for simulating bridge mechanics.
- Start with simple prototypes: Focus on core mechanics like placing beams and simulating weight before adding complex features.
- Implement clear visual cues: Use color coding or deformation indicators to show stress points and potential failure areas.
- Optimize performance: Physics simulations can be computationally intensive; optimize calculations to maintain smooth gameplay, especially on mobile devices.
- Incorporate user feedback: Playtesting helps identify confusing controls, unrealistic physics, or difficulty spikes that could turn players away.